Bastian Joachim is a scholar working on Geophysics, Materials Chemistry and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ials. According to data from OpenAlex, Bastian Joachim has authored 28 papers receiving a total of 399 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 16 papers in Geophysics, 9 papers in Materials Chemistry and 9 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ials. Recurrent topics in Bastian Joachim’s work include Geological and Geochemical Analysis (14 papers), High-pressure geophysics and materials (13 papers) and Crystal Structures and Properties (9 papers). Bastian Joachim is often cited by papers focused on Geological and Geochemical Analysis (14 papers), High-pressure geophysics and materials (13 papers) and Crystal Structures and Properties (9 papers). Bastian Joachim collaborates with scholars based in Austria, Germany and United Kingdom. Bastian Joachim's co-authors include P. L. Clay, C. J. Ballentine, R. Burgess, Rainer Abart, Hubert Huppertz, Emmanuel Gardés, Francesco Vetere, Wilhelm Heinrich, Alan Whittington and Harald Behrens and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Angewandte Chemie International Edition and Geochimica et Cosmochimica Acta.
